DESCRIPTION:

BRIEF SUMMARY
This invention relates to a clutch release apparatus for use with motor vehicle clutch actuation systems.
Motor vehicle transmissions frequently comprise a clutch and a gear box whose input shaft is driven through the clutch so that the drive of the gearbox can be broken by operation of a hydraulicably operable slave cylinder. It has become more common for the slave cylinder to be an annular slave cylinder arranged concentrically of the gear box input shaft.
The concentric slave cylinder is frequently fixed to a face of the gearbox housing within the confines of the gearbox bell housing. Due to dimensional limitations it is becoming necessary for the concentric slave cylinder to become more compact.
Accordingly there is provided a hydraulic annular slave cylinder for a motor vehicle clutch comprising an annular body having inner and outer cylindrical walls forming a hydraulic chamber therebetween, a piston member responsive to hydraulic pressure within the chamber and a release bearing characterised in that the release bearing is mounted on the piston member so that the bearing is concentric with a hydraulic fluid chamber.
Preferably the inner wall extends axially beyond the outer wall and the piston member is sealingly slideable on the radially outer surfaces of the two walls.
The piston member may be sealed to the inner wall by a first seal mounted on the piston member and may be sealed to the outer wall by a second seal mounted on the outer wall.
Preferably the piston member comprises a cylindrical side wall and a radially inwardly projecting flange at one end thereof, the cylindrical side wall being slideably supported on the radially outer surface of the outer cylindrical wall, and radially inner flange sealingly engaging the radially outer surface of the inner wail, and annular relase bearing may be concentric with the fluid chamber formed by the piston member.
The piston member may further include a secondary piston slideably mounted thereon, the secondary piston forming a second fluid chamber, and the annular release bearing is concentric with the second fluid chamber.
Preferably an annular release bearing is mounted on the outer surface of the cylindrical sidewall of the piston member.

Now with reference to FIG. 1, a motor vehicle transmission includes a friction clutch 11, and a gear box assembly 12. The gearbox assembly 12 has an input shaft 13 driven by the clutch 11, and a bell housing 14 which houses the clutch and which in use is bolted against a face of an internal compustion engine (not shown).
The clutch 11 is operated by an annular hydraulic clutch slave cylinder 16 arranged concentrically with the gearbox input shaft 13 and in use engages the radially inner ends of the fingers 19 of a diaphragm spring. The slave cylinder is operated by hydraulic fluid pressure generated by a master cylinder (not shown) which is connected to the slave cylinder 16 by conduit 17.
Now with reference to FIG. 2, there is illustrated, in the actuated condition, an annular clutch slave cylinder 16 arranged concentrically with the gearbox input shaft 13. The slave cylinder 16 has an annular body 21 having an inner cylindrical wall 22 and an outer cylindrical wall 23 spaced radially outwardly thereof. The inner wall 22 extends axially beyond the outer wall 23.
